What sings? Launch speed outpaces my morning alarm. During daycare emergencies, it opens before panic fully registers. The standalone design is genius - no Google account tether means I finally own my schedule. But I crave cross-device sync. Last Tuesday, scribbling a supplier's new contact on my tablet meant double-entry on my phone. Still, watching ads vanish after in-app purchase felt like unlocking premium tranquility.
